Dammam Port: Dammam Port is the largest port in the Eastern Province of Saudi Arabia and is strategically located on the Arabian Gulf. It is a key gateway for trade between Saudi Arabia and the rest of the world. The port has modern facilities and infrastructure to handle various types of cargo including containers, bulk, and general cargo. Dammam Port plays a crucial role in the country's economy by facilitating the import and export of goods.
Jeddah Port: Jeddah Port is the largest seaport in the Red Sea and is a major gateway for trade to and from Saudi Arabia. It is located in the western part of the country and serves as a vital link between the Middle East, Africa, and Europe. Jeddah Port is equipped with state-of-the-art facilities for handling containers, bulk cargo, and oil shipments. It plays a crucial role in facilitating the transportation of goods to and from the Kingdom.
Jubail Port: Jubail Port is located on the Arabian Gulf and is one of the busiest ports in Saudi Arabia. It is a key hub for petrochemical exports and plays a significant role in the country's industrial development. Jubail Port has specialized terminals for handling oil, gas, and chemical products. It also has excellent facilities for handling containers and general cargo. The port is an important gateway for the export of petrochemical products to international markets.
King Abdullah Port: King Abdullah Port is a state-of-the-art container port located in King Abdullah Economic City on the Red Sea coast. It is one of the newest and most modern ports in Saudi Arabia, equipped with cutting-edge technology and infrastructure. King Abdullah Port has the capacity to handle large container vessels and is strategically positioned to serve as a transshipment hub for the region. The port plays a crucial role in enhancing Saudi Arabia's maritime connectivity and trade competitiveness.
Riyadh Port: Riyadh Port is a inland dry port located in the capital city of Riyadh. It serves as a key logistics hub for the central region of Saudi Arabia, providing connectivity to the country's major cities and industrial centers. Riyadh Port primarily handles containerized cargo, providing efficient transport and distribution services to businesses in the region. The port plays a vital role in supporting the growth of trade and commerce in the central part of the Kingdom.
Other ports in Saudi Arabia include: Yanbu Port, Yanbu Industrial Port, Jizan Port, Ras Tanura Port.
Atico Port: Atico Port is a small port located in the Arequipa region of Peru. It primarily serves as a fishing port, handling the export of fish products. The port is not as large or developed as some of the other ports in Peru, but it plays an important role in the local economy.
Callao Port: Callao Port is the largest and most important port in Peru, located near the capital city of Lima. It is a major hub for both commercial and container shipping, handling a significant portion of the country's import and export activities. The port is equipped with modern facilities and infrastructure to accommodate large cargo ships.
Ilo Port: Ilo Port is located in the southern part of Peru, near the border with Chile. It is a key port for the mining industry, particularly for the export of copper and other minerals. The port is equipped with specialized terminals for handling bulk cargo, making it an important player in the region's economy.
Matarani Port: Matarani Port is another important port in southern Peru, serving as a gateway for both commercial and container shipping. The port handles a diverse range of goods, including minerals, agricultural products, and consumer goods. Matarani Port is strategically located near major highways and railroads, facilitating the transportation of goods to and from the port.
Paita Port: Paita Port is located in northern Peru, near the city of Piura. It is a key port for the export of agricultural products, particularly fruits and vegetables. The port is equipped with modern facilities and refrigeration capabilities to handle perishable goods. Paita Port plays a crucial role in supporting the region's agricultural sector.
Other ports in Peru include Salaverry Port, San Martin Port, Chimbote Port, and Puerto Maldonado Port.

Shipping cargo from Saudi Arabia to Peru by sea typically takes around 30-45 days. The exact duration can vary depending on factors such as the specific ports of departure and arrival, the shipping route, weather conditions, and the type of cargo being transported. For example, shipping from Jeddah, Saudi Arabia to Callao, Peru is estimated to take around 30-35 days. The speed of shipping can also be influenced by the choice of shipping method - whether it be via container ships, bulk carriers, or other vessels.
Customs clearance plays a crucial role in determining the overall shipping time from Saudi Arabia to Peru. Saudi Arabia has a relatively efficient customs process, with an average clearance time of 2-3 days. On the other hand, Peru may have longer clearance times, averaging around 4-5 days. To mitigate delays, shippers can ensure that all necessary documentation is in order and that the cargo complies with customs regulations in both countries.
